Transaction 3e94e7234fcaefe521a2cd7ef6654ca2f900a782193cf69bf8524a2e125f43ea

2 Input
2 Outputs
  • 3e94e7234fcaefe521a2cd7ef6654ca2f900a782193cf69bf8524a2e125f43ea:0
  • value  941177
    address  1EugtH1ZfDG2t2h3K34bbUeesRnwuHvgF7
  • 3e94e7234fcaefe521a2cd7ef6654ca2f900a782193cf69bf8524a2e125f43ea:1
  • value  11902858
    address  365w6j7VMHAyaTztBUQbxZF4vXtNV1Uvsr